Port Manatee Joins USDA Pilot Program For Importation Of Cold-Treated Produce
September 14, 2015 | 1 min to read
PALMETTO, Fla. – Port Manatee has gained federal approval to receive direct imports of select cold-treated South American produce via an expanding pilot program.
Port Manatee may begin participation in the Florida Perishables Trade Coalition pilot program effective Oct. 1, according to approval received Sept. 10 from officials of the U.S. Department of Agriculture’s Animal and Plant Health Inspection Service.
“We are enthusiastic about the opportunities our participation in this pilot program offers as Port Manatee looks to advance as Florida’s leading on-dock cold storage port,” said Carlos Buqueras, Port Manatee’s executive director.
